We are running our annual club hill climb on the 4th October.  We are having to make some alterations to the usual running of the event to ensure the safety of competitors and the general public in light of the ongoing Covid-19 pandemic. We are asking riders to abide by some simple rules to enable us to run the event safely. We feel it is important to note that a “return to new normality” is a key governmental strategy, and by holding events with consideration to COVID-19 demonstrates an agile approach to this strategy whilst keeping people safe. 

Pre event rider info: 

Riders must use a working rear light during the event.

Please bring your OWN pen to the sign on. 

Please wear a face covering at sign on.

There is to be no gathering at the sign on, for your own safety and the safety of others, please sign on and don’t hang around. Please maintain 2m distance when signing on.

Anyone can ride as long as you are over 12 years old. 

All competitors at the start will be required to have one foot on the ground as there will be no pusher / starter. 

You will get a paper number at sign on. You will not have to return this number. To maintain social distancing, riders need to pin their own numbers on.

There will be no results at the event. Please DO NOT ask the timekeeper for your times. Results will be posted as soon as possible after the event. 

Absolutely no spectating or gathering on the course, or near the start or finish line.

    1. Hi Coral, we will have a small number of people marshalling the event to monitor safety and ensure people do not gather at any time. We have extended the sign-on time to facilitate social distancing. Riders will be given a designated start time and asked not to go to the start line before that time and will be asked to disperse if they do so. No spectators are permitted and riders are under strict instructions to leave immediately following the event. We are taking social distancing and infection prevention measures very seriously, in line with guidance provided by the Cycling Time Trials association. We do not anticipate any close contact need occur between riders and people not participating in the event. Thank you for getting in touch.
